Bare ActsThe Meghalaya State Agricultural Produce and Livestock Marketing (Promotion and Facilitation) Act, 2020 (Act No. 9 of 2020)

Section 23

Election of Chairman.

Amendment status not verified — confirm the current text below against the official source.

(1) Every person shall, unless disqualified under the provisions of this Act or any other law for time being inforce, as the Chairman of the Market Committee, be qualified to be elected by direct election by the persons qualified to vote for the election of representatives of agriculturists under Section 20, traders, commission agents and other market functionaries under Section 18: Provided that no person shall be eligible for election as Chairman unless he is qualified to be elected under Section 20. (2) Reservation of seats to election of the Chairman for scheduled castes, scheduled tribes, other backward classes and women will be as per the Government policy, as may be prescribed. (3) No person shall be eligible to contest election simultaneously for office of the Chairman and a Member. (4) If any delineated market area fails to elect a Chairman, fresh election proceedings shall be initiated to fill the office within six months: Provided further that pending the election of Chairman under this sub section, the officer authorized by the Director shall discharge all the functions of the Chairman.
